-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 El 2007-05-14 a las 20:44 +0200, Chema Ollés escribió:
Vamos a ver,prueba esto: 1-Crea una lista con los directorios que quieras leer,y la llamas,por ejemplo,dat.log En tu caso dat.log tendría: dira dirb dirc dir d
Luego creas el script que sería algo asi:
for n in $(seq $(grep -c $ dat.log)) do directorio="$(sed -n ${n}p dat.log)" echo $directorio done exit
Para hacerlo mediante fichero, más fácil así: while read LINEA ; do echo $LINEA done < dat.log Tres líneas y sin seq ni grep ni na. - -- Saludos Carlos E.R. -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.5 (GNU/Linux) Comment: Made with pgp4pine 1.76 iD8DBQFGSMAOtTMYHG2NR9URAjmvAJ4zgSLowlX9I6TIGGteIMzgq3i0JwCdEmno DP7DdH1vUdJB9ZyIFq7P+0c= =O9zg -----END PGP SIGNATURE-----